Why Paint Protection Matters in Stone Oak

Stone Oak's location means vehicles deal with relentless UV exposure, high heat, seasonal dust, and road contamination year-round. Without a protective barrier on the paint, these elements work against the clear coat daily — breaking down gloss, oxidizing color, and making surfaces harder to clean with every passing week.

A quality wax or paint sealant applied after detailing creates a sacrificial layer that absorbs what would otherwise affect the clear coat directly. UV blockers slow oxidation. Hydrophobic properties cause water, mud, and grime to bead and sheet off rather than bonding to the surface. The result is paint that stays cleaner between washes and looks better for longer.

Paint protection is not optional for vehicles in San Antonio's climate — it is the practical difference between maintaining an attractive vehicle and watching it fade and oxidize ahead of schedule.

What Paint Protection Does

UV Blocking
Filters UV radiation that breaks down clear coat and oxidizes paint color. Especially critical under Texas's intense sun.
Water Beading
Hydrophobic surface causes water to bead and roll off rather than sitting on paint and leaving mineral deposits.
Grime Resistance
Contaminants bond to the protective layer instead of the paint surface — making washing faster and safer.
Gloss Enhancement
Wax and sealant fill in micro-surface texture and add depth, improving gloss and reflectivity immediately after application.
Road Grime Barrier
A barrier between paint and road film, bug splatter, bird droppings, and brake dust reduces the etching risk from each.
Easier Maintenance
Protected surfaces clean faster and require less effort — a significant benefit for vehicles washed regularly.

Paint Protection Options

From basic maintenance wax to long-term ceramic coating — we match protection to your goals and budget.

Spray Wax
Lasts 4–8 weeks

Applied after every maintenance detail or wash. Provides immediate gloss and a basic hydrophobic barrier. The entry-level protection option — fast to apply, frequently refreshed. Ideal for vehicles on a regular detail schedule.

Paint Sealant
Lasts 3–6 months

Synthetic polymer sealant bonds more durably to paint than carnauba wax. Better UV resistance, stronger water beading, and longer protection window. Applied after a thorough wash and decontamination. Best for daily drivers wanting reliable protection between full details.

Ceramic Coating
Lasts 2–5 years

Semi-permanent nano-ceramic layer that chemically bonds to the clear coat. Hardest surface protection available short of paint protection film. Extreme hydrophobicity, UV resistance, and chemical resistance. Applied only over corrected, properly prepared paint. Longest-lasting and most comprehensive protection option.

What is the difference between wax and sealant?

Wax (typically carnauba-based) provides warm gloss and basic protection lasting four to eight weeks. Sealant is a synthetic polymer that bonds more durably, lasts three to six months, and provides stronger UV and water resistance. Sealant is generally the better choice for vehicles in Stone Oak's climate.

Do I need paint correction before protection?

For wax and sealant, correction is not required — though the vehicle should be properly washed and decontaminated first. For ceramic coating, paint correction is strongly recommended. Coating applied over swirl marks and defects permanently locks them in under the protective layer.

How often should paint protection be reapplied?

Spray wax applied at each maintenance detail (every four to eight weeks) keeps consistent coverage. A standalone sealant application lasts three to six months and should be refreshed twice a year at minimum. Ceramic coating lasts two to five years depending on the product and care.

Does paint protection prevent scratches?

Wax and sealant provide minimal protection against physical scratches — they primarily guard against UV, chemical etching, and contamination bonding. Ceramic coating adds some surface hardness that resists light marring, but paint protection film (PPF) is the appropriate choice for physical scratch prevention on high-impact areas.
